Infinity Softworks Propels powerOne™ Graph into Vanguard with Advanced, New Features
Beaverton, OR -- August 18, 2004 -- Infinity Softworks, Inc. today announced the release of an upgrade, version 4.2, for powerOne Graph, graphing-scientific calculator software. powerOne Graph brings TI-83/84 functionality to a Palm OS handheld computer, taking advantage of the handheld computer's touch-screen, color and improved usability.
"Again and again, we listen to and provide the advanced functionality that our users are requesting," said Elia Freedman, CEO of Infinity Softworks. "In this way, powerOne Graph users continue to have the best user and feature experience on their Palm OS devices."
The new version includes the following additions:
- Function and polar equations can reference another graph equation by name.
- Crop data while in the Graph view.
- Derivative graphing analysis now includes second derivative.
- Maximum and minimum limits for graphing function equations.
- Changed how calculus functions handled tolerance.
- Added first and third quartile to the calculator function list.
- Improved integral function for increased precision.
- Implicit multiplication.
- Polynomial root finding.
- Out of the box, now supports 160x160, 320x320, 320x480, 480x320 and 160x520 display sizes. 160x520 for graph window only.

Pricing and Availability
Version 4.2 of powerOne Graph is immediately available for purchase through electronic download or CD from Infinity Softworks' web site at http://www.infinitysw.com/graph. It is also available through online resellers Amazon, Handango and PalmGear, and education resellers such as AlphaSmart, Scantron and K12 Handhelds.
Suggested retail price is US$59.99. Education discounts and volume pricing are available. The upgrade is available free to current version 4 customers.
powerOne Graph is compatible with devices running Palm OS version 3.1 or higher, including devices from palmOne, AlphaSmart, and Sony.
About Infinity Softworks
Infinity Softworks has distributed over 15 million calculation software products since its inception in 1997. Its software calculators, which perform business/finance, graphing, scientific and general mathematics calculations, run on Palm OS, Pocket PC and Windows computers. In its history, Infinity Softworks has been bundled with palmOne, Sony, Garmin, Handspring and ViewSonic devices. The company is headquartered in Beaverton, OR.
